4-5 hour tour
Trieste, a town epitomizing cosmopolitism, historically astride the Latin, Slav and German worlds, has been able to tap the richness of the meeting of peoples, standing out as the most diverse of Italian towns. The suggested tour will lead you to discover the multi-cultural aspects of the town, which you can trace in the buildings, historic residences, and in the presence of places of worship of different religions.
The tour starts from the San Giusto Hill, with a visit inside the Cathedral, a casket full of history, art and archaeology. Then we are going to pass alongside the Roman Theatre, arriving in the Borgo Teresiano, which reached its apex under the Habsburg Empire.
A stop in a typical buffet to taste the traditional "cotto nel pan" ham, accompanied by a good glass of wine.
Then the tour of the Greek-Orthodox church of San Nicolò dei Greci, and of the Serbian-Orthodox San Spiridione is next. The tour terminates inside the monumental Synagogue of Trieste, the symbol of the prestige won by the Jewish community at the end of the 19th century.
